Meet Kara
Kara Pinksen
Therapist / Social Worker (MSW/RSW)
Registered in Nova Scotia and Newfoundland
Therapy is one of the hardest and most rewarding things you can do for yourself. My goal as a therapist is that you leave the session feeling heard, understood and unjudged; with tools and confidence to make positive change in your life.
I have 22 years of experience working with adults, adolescents, children, couples and families. I specialize in Trauma, Addiction and Anxiety, and concerns related to gender and/or sexuality.
I would describe my approach as energetic, hopeful and solution-focused, with a dash of humour and laughter. I incorporate body and breathwork, and other somatic strategies to enhance and help maintain change.
The therapeutic modalities I draw from most are ACT, CBT, DBT, IFS, and SFT. I am also a practitioner of ART (Accelerated Resolution Therapy) and Auricular Acupuncture.
